Salt "Spalling"
Harbor fog is heavy with salt. It soaks deep into the porous granite. When the sun hits the stone, the water evaporates, but the salt stays inside.
The salt crystallizes and expands. It exerts massive pressure inside the rock. This pressure blasts small chips of stone off the face. We call this "spalling."

Recycled Water Scale
Cemeteries here use reclaimed water. It is high in minerals. When sprinklers hit a hot headstone, the water boils off instantly.
The minerals bake onto the surface. They form a hard, white crust that bonds like cement. It hides the name.
